This Hearty Walk started as a bit of community Hearty positive health fun and we personally believe this is the start of something beautiful. Eight years ago I also lost my dad to a heart attack and each year we plan to support the BHF as we raise the profile of positive health awareness.
Birthing Link is currently a voluntary run, non for profit organisation with a mission to help wider communities with our positive health and education approach. Although we work directly with parents and the community we plan to extend our support into Schools. The BHF will always be the charity we support and promote and many of you asked “what’s next”:
- The sponsorships and donations you raised will be shared equally between the BHF and Birthing Link. No administration, insurance and pre event expenses will be taken from the total amount raised.
- Birthing Link plans to support the start of a new teenage run initiative community group POP (paged out project). This will involve year 10 students from Arun and Chichester schools as they work together and towards a one day community event around July 2011 (so watch this space).
